I saw him vague
in shadowing
no definition
drawn by lines
smoke gray spirit
hovering
a fog
that grasped
the warm concrete
in desperate need
of something real
as the bats
played tag at dusk.

I saw him fall.
Instinctively
I tried to reach--
there I met myself
in sieve
aware of this divide.

I watched him bleeding
helplessly
wondering
intent of screen--
was it there
placed with the care
to keep things out
or lock me in?
